Bonne Terre sits in the lead belt region of St. Francois County, about an hour south of our Pacific office. The community has a strong identity tied to its mining heritage, and the housing stock reflects several eras of development — older homes near the historic mine site, mid-century neighborhoods, and newer construction on the outskirts. At this distance from our office we focus primarily on full replacements and storm restoration projects where the scope justifies the drive, and we are upfront about that with homeowners who call us.
The Ozark foothills terrain around Bonne Terre creates localized weather patterns that can produce significant hail and wind events that do not always register as major events in St. Louis media. Homeowners in this area sometimes do not realize they have storm damage because the event was not widely reported. Cost depends on roof size, pitch, complexity, material, and the condition of the decking underneath. Rather than quote a range that will not apply to your home, we inspect at no charge and give you a written number. If you want a sense of monthly cost first, our financing calculator will show you a payment estimate without anyone contacting you.
Most residential roofs are torn off and installed in a single day. Larger roofs, steep pitch, multiple planes, or extensive decking replacement can extend that to two or three days.
